What Does Final Expense Insurance Insure?
As you may have guessed from the name, burial insurance covers your funeral expenses. This includes obvious things like purchasing your final resting place, buying the coffin (or cremation costs), paying for your funeral service, and purchasing a headstone.
Other lesser known costs that may often be covered are things like floral arrangements and grave digging. They’re able to accumulate quickly, although they are not large on their very own.
For an unprepared family who may not get a large amount of disposable income, these costs (which may run into the tens of tens of thousands of dollars) can be a serious jolt. Many families turn to banks to get loans, being in debt to pay the funeral costs of a family member isn’t a pleasant feeling off. Especially when you’re attempting to grieve.

Prices for burial insurance strategies differ tremendously between suppliers. Some basic coverage plans may start from just a few dollars a week, however there are exceptionally complete plans that cost more.
You can find policies that provide coverage up to $50k although the policies normally provide coverage between $5000 and $25,000 but on However as you can visualize, higher fees are required by better coverage.
Most payments are created monthly, but there are some strategies that accept weekly payments too.
The amount you have to pay is largely decided by your actual age. The old you are, the more your premiums are going to be. It’s simple economics really if you’re mathematically closer to death ” you are likely to need to cover more over a shorter amount of time. Because of their lifespans that are mathematically shorter, guys tend to cover more for final expense insurance than women.
This can be one of the motives that lots of people strongly advise that you take out burial insurance early on. A life of almost unnoticeably small payments is significantly better than trying to make fewer larger payments when you are often relying on a pension for income.

Your health also plays a large part in your premiums. If you’ve got a history of serious health issues, your premium will probably be greater. It’s beneficial to understand that different insurance companies have various standards. Therefore, should you have health problems, it pays to look around.
There is going to be a sizable difference in quality between insurance companies, so do your research and find out which supplier provides you with the perfect balance between price and coverage.
